A light earthquake magnitude 4.1 (ml/mb) has occurred on Sunday, 61 kilometers (38 miles) from Shikotan in Russia. Exact location of earthquake, 146.3838° East, 43.2982° North, depth 87.761 km. A tsunami warning has not been issued (Does not indicate if a tsunami actually did or will exist). The temblor was picked up at 00:53:14 / 12:53 am (local time epicenter). The earthquake was roughly at a depth of 87.761 km (55 miles). Date and time of earthquake in UTC/GMT: 22/06/25 / 2025-06-22 00:53:14 / June 22, 2025 @ 12:53 am. Id of earthquake: us7000qamv. Event ids that are associated: us7000qamv.
Nearby country/countries, Japan (c. 127 288 000 pop) (That might be effected). Epicenter of the earthquake was 65 km (41 miles) from Nemuro (c. 31 200 pop), 91 km (57 miles) from Yuzhno-Kuril’sk (c. 6 500 pop). Closest city/cities or villages, with min 5000 pop, to hypocenter/epicentrum was Yuzhno-Kuril’sk, Nemuro.
Earthquakes 4.0 to 5.0 are often felt, but only causes minor damage. Each year there are an estimated 13,000 light earthquakes in the world. In the past 24 hours, there have been thirteen, in the last 10 days fifteen, in the past 30 days sixteen and in the last 365 days fifty-five earthquakes of magnitude 3.0 or greater that have been detected in the same area.
